Library support

Librarians can help you with:

  • how and where to start researching your topic
  • effective use of databases and the Internet
  • finding and evaluating information
  • using the Library's collections

Learning skills advisers assist students improve their academic language and approaches to learning, including:

  • academic English
  • study methods and exam preparation
  • effective listening and note-taking
  • problem-solving and critical thinking
  • reading strategies
  • essay, report and thesis writing
  • oral communication and presentation

Drop-in sessions with learning skills advisers are offered at all Library branches and run from Week 2 to Week 14 (except non-teaching week).

Access recommended readings

The Library web page of selected lists makes accessing your readings easy.

The lists are listed by unit code, or you can search in the Library catalogue using the unit code, eg edf4113 or edf4004 (no space between the letters and numbers).

Click on the link

  • to read the full-text chapters, articles and e-books on your computer, or
  • to find the shelf location of the book or dvd.
    Some key books may be held in the Reserve collection
